Govt approves time-off for public sector workers to participate in Ram Navami

0

Vice President Dr. Bharrat Jagdeo today joined worshippers at the Ogle Sanatan Dharma Sabha Mandir for Ram Navami observances.

During his address, the Vice President announced that Cabinet has approved time-off for public sector workers now and in the future, enabling them to participate fully in the religious activities associated with Ram Navami.

Rama Navami is a Hindu festival that celebrates the birth of Rama, a revered deity in Hinduism, also known as the seventh avatar of Vishnu. He is often held as an emblem within Hinduism for being an ideal king and human, through his righteousness, good conduct and virtue.
